One-pot shrimp and tomato pasta

"Summer holidays are officially over, but that doesn't mean you can't put a little holiday vibe on your plate. I love simple and hassle-free recipes, and this restaurant-worthy recipe is ridiculously easy. The combination of shrimps, tangy cherry tomatoes, and buttery white wine sauce will make it your new favorite one-pot pasta. In this recipe, we used black tiger shrimp, but you can use other types of shrimps and prawns."

Ingredients

2Servings
MetricImperial
200 g
shrimp
250 g
spaghetti
350 g
cherry tomatoes
50 ml
white wine
1 tbsp
butter
2 cloves
garlic
1
chili
600 ml
water
4 tbsp
olive oil
10 g
basil (for garnish)
salt
pepper

  • Step 1/4

    Peel and slice the garlic. Halve the cherry tomatoes. Remove the seeds from the chili and slice thinly. Heat half of the olive oil in a large pan and sear the shrimp for approx. 1 min. on each side. Remove shrimp from the pan and set it aside in a small bowl.

  • Step 2/4

    In the same pan heat the remaining olive oil. Add garlic, chili, and tomatoes and sauté together for approx. 2 min. Then deglaze with white wine.  Let simmer for approx. 2 min. until the wine has almost boiled away. Season everything with a generous pinch of salt and pepper.

  • Step 3/4

    Add spaghetti to the pan, and add the water. The pasta should be completely covered with water. Season the water with salt. Put the lid on and simmer for approx. 9 min. Mix everything after a few minutes, so that it doesn't stick together, add more salt to your taste.

  • Step 4/4

    Remove the lid, add the butter, and let simmer for another 5 min., until the sauce is thick and glossy. Finally, add shrimp and warm through briefly. Arrange pasta on plates and garnish with basil leaves.
